Without people, an ad agency is no more than a stack of business cards, a computer or two, a conference table and chairs and maybe some awards. Fundamentally, an ad agency is a group of people who work together to come up with creative ideas to change the behavior of a target audience in order to achieve a marketing goal for their client. It's important that everyone, regardless of disability, has unabated access to information on the web. People with disabilities should be able to comprehend, navigate, and interact with the web just like anyone else. Who doesn't like the idea of more people using their websites? Visual Impairment Snapshot Just focusing on visually impaired Americans alone: 4% Legally Blind 9% color blind 14+% with visual difficulties This equates to millions of people!
